Power element can be a expression generally employed When it comes to the effectiveness of an electrical power distribution method. Power factor or displacement ability variable is often a measurement involving The present and voltage phase change waveforms, dependent upon the (fifty Hz) essential frequency in Iraq. Distortion electricity element requires under consideration harmonics which is measured in root mean sq. (RMS) values.
Influence of Electrical hundreds
Normally electrical loads are resistive, inductive, and involve equally linear and non-linear components. Most professional and industrial alternating existing (AC) hundreds are inductive, resulting from the nature of the types of equipment linked over the electrical technique. Specific industries wherever energy component could be significant are steel/foundries, chemical compounds, textiles, pulp and paper, automotive, rubber and plastics. Several examples of kit utilized, in which ability element is a priority, may involve; transformers, motors, lighting, arc welders, and induction furnaces, all which call for reactive ability to create an electromagnetic subject for Procedure. This kind of products can deliver poor, or even a very low, power aspect, measured in the decimal vogue, such as .70 (70% of value).
Very best situation a (unity electricity element)
Unity electricity issue of one.0 (one hundred%), is often viewed as suitable. However, for most users of electrical energy, energy aspect is normally under 100%, which means the electrical power is not effectively used. This inefficiency can improve the price of the user’s electric power, since the Vitality or electric utility company transfers its have surplus operational fees on towards the person. Billing of electric power is computed by a variety of strategies, which can also have an impact on fees.
From the electric utility’s watch, elevating the average running energy variable on the network from .70 to .90 means:
one. cutting down fees due to losses while in the network
2. expanding the likely of technology creation and distribution of community operations

This implies preserving numerous Many plenty of gasoline (and emissions), a huge selection of transformers starting to be accessible, rather than being forced to Develop electricity crops as well as their help programs. Thus in the case of minimal electrical power issue, utility providers charge larger costs so that you can include the additional fees they need to incur, due to inefficiency of your system that taps Power.
Electrical power issue contains 3 parts:

1. kW (Doing work or authentic electric power),
two. kVA (evident electricity),
3. KVAR (reactive electrical power).

KW “performs” the actual perform, whereas KVAR doesn't “carry out” any advantageous get the job done, as a substitute only retaining magnetic fields. The connection between kW and KVA is the KVAR .Where by relevant; most tools can have a nameplate rating,
which incorporates recent, voltage, kVA, additionally kW and PF.

Improvement Case in point

If we take into account a Load of 100kVA with Existing PF .eighty, Amount of 100 watt light-weight bulbs = 800.New PF (with capacitors) .95 leads us to a completely new Amount of 100 watt light-weight bulbs = 950

Correction or enhancement of poor electric power element will:
one. Decrease electricity expenditures
2. Raise kVA functionality
three. Boost kW for a similar kVA demand
four. Boost voltage regulation (drop),
5. Allow for for measurement reductions in cable, transformers & switchgear
